factor/core/optimizer
Slava Pestov fc9e87db1c Tweak method inlining heuristic a bit 2008-07-04 04:41:27 -05:00
..
backend Move mirrors out of the boot image 2008-07-02 00:20:01 -05:00
collect Improve recursive word type inference 2008-04-19 02:11:55 -05:00
control Mandatory stack effect annotations 2008-06-08 15:32:55 -05:00
def-use Mirrors now check sot t slot types, support type coercion for setters, instance? now infers, better transform for 'new', more efficient 'case' where keys are all wrappers 2008-06-29 02:12:44 -05:00
inlining Tweak method inlining heuristic a bit 2008-07-04 04:41:27 -05:00
known-words Expand boa constructors later to avoid issue where compiler inserts calls to 'curry' in unsafe code 2008-07-04 04:18:40 -05:00
math Builtinn types now use new slot accessors; tuple slot type declaration work in progress 2008-06-28 02:36:20 -05:00
pattern-match Class linearization 2008-05-02 02:51:38 -05:00
specializers Builtinn types now use new slot accessors; tuple slot type declaration work in progress 2008-06-28 02:36:20 -05:00
authors.txt Initial import 2007-09-20 18:09:08 -04:00
optimizer-docs.factor More efficient specializers 2008-02-05 20:11:35 -06:00
optimizer-tests.factor Mirrors now check sot t slot types, support type coercion for setters, instance? now infers, better transform for 'new', more efficient 'case' where keys are all wrappers 2008-06-29 02:12:44 -05:00
optimizer.factor Improve recursive word type inference 2008-04-19 02:11:55 -05:00
summary.txt Initial import 2007-09-20 18:09:08 -04:00
tags.txt Initial import 2007-09-20 18:09:08 -04:00